I am ALMOST done with my install and will report back, but I believe it really only gives you a safety net, as well as the chance to bump timing. Moving timing will be the performance gain, the injection just supports the change.
 
Zero if not tuned properly.

Zero - 15hp if tuned properly for a Land Cruiser.

30-45hp if tuned improperly for a Land Cruiser.


If you just throw water/meth on and don't tune the system properly you will see very little if any gains at all. By tuning properly I mean knowing your IAT's, finding the correct nozzle size, adjusting the proper start time and flow rate for the pump, etc.

In a non-Land Cruiser application with similar power output you could make more power by adding more boost and timing and compensating with the higher octane and cooled air charge. I don't recommend that in an LC since you could be very far away from methanol sources. So my take with water/meth on a post OBDII Land Cruiser is just use it as an extra safety feature but don't tune the truck to the point it has to have it.

I've never used it on a Cruiser, but on another truck it has allowed me to advance the timing and add more boost. While it may not affect peak hp much, it does seem to broaden the curve and give more power on average throughout the RPM range.

No the stock computer will not make any adjustments you will need a water/meth controller that is sold usually in the kit. There are a couple different ways to do it, but for the TRD SC I would recommend MAF voltage.

No one uses water or washer fluid (meth/water) on land cruisers? Water takes a lot more heat to vaporize than alcohols. More heat lost = more knock resistance. Google enthalpy. Plus you can buy washer fluid at every gas station for a couple bucks. I've tuned a few +1000whp supercharged Vipers with washer fluid. Efective, cheap, less corrosive & available.

I would recommend anyone tuning on your own to get a set of electronic knock ears setup. (pizo mic, hearing aid amp, headphones) You can easily build it for $50 and it could save your engine and make more power safely. It's not hard to hear knock as well as a high-tech Bosch knock sensor processed by an ECM. The human brain is a pretty good signal processor it turns out!
